Who We Are

Founded in 1887, St. Helena High School is a comprehensive and Western Association of Schools and Colleges-accredited high school serving 413 students in grades 9 through 12. We are nestled in rural St. Helena in the heart of Napa Valley. For 2024-2025, we offer College Preparatory, Honors, Advanced Placement and Dual Enrollment colleges courses, while providing students eight pathways in Career and Technology Education.

Welcome to St. Helena High School

Welcome to St. Helena High School!  SHHS is proud to offer rigorous coursework in both academic and Career Technical Education (CTE) arenas. Although our student population is small, the school boasts award-winning offerings similar to those of schools with large student populations. This has been made tangible in our recognition as a California Gold Ribbon School, AP News and World Report Silver Ranking as one of America’s Best High Schools, and identification on the 6th Annual Advance Placement Honor Roll, a recognition bestowed to a mere 425 high schools in all of North America.  Additionally, SHHS staff provide students with a most safe and nurturing environment, maintaining a School Climate Index in the ninety-nine percentile.

At SHHS, we strive to provide our students with an outstanding education that ensures each student will be prepared to meet the demands of their chosen postsecondary option. The importance placed upon perseverance and hard work echoes in every aspect of the curriculum and school culture. Students are encouraged and supported to develop their unique abilities and interests in an atmosphere that celebrates their successes while challenging their intellectual, social and physical capacity, a.k.a., our students have grit. Our ultimate goal is to assist students in finding their voice in a community of learners while exploring areas of interest, ultimately ensuring college and career readiness.  With a near non-existent dropout rate and approximately 95% college attendance rate, our students have been overwhelmingly successful at achieving just that.

St. Helena High School offers Advanced Placement, Honors, college preparatory, elective and Career Technical Education courses. The school teaches students to be globally competitive citizens armed with the necessary 21st-century skills to be successful in postsecondary educational institutions or the workforce. The school has a vibrant Career Technical Education program as well as an AVID program that boasts a 95 percent college-acceptance rate. Students are able to receive academic and social counseling with the assistance of two counselors and Student Support Services coordinator.

SHHS maintains a two-day block schedule with weekly time (Access Period) for students to meet with their teachers for remediation, review or enrichment. Through Access, the continual monitoring of student progress, benchmark data, and Aeries, the high school is working to increase student learning and school-to-home communication.
